| 17 | #include "entry_name_utils-inl.h" |
| 18 | |
| 19 | #include <gtest/gtest.h> |
| 20 | |
| 21 | TEST(entry_name_utils, NullChars) { |
| 22 | // 'A', 'R', '\0', 'S', 'E' |
| 23 | const uint8_t zeroes[] = { 0x41, 0x52, 0x00, 0x53, 0x45 }; |
| 24 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(zeroes, sizeof(zeroes))); |
| 25 | |
| 26 | const uint8_t zeroes_continuation_chars[] = { 0xc2, 0xa1, 0xc2, 0x00 }; |
| 27 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(zeroes_continuation_chars, |
| 28 | sizeof(zeroes_continuation_chars))); |
| 29 | } |
| 30 | |
| 31 | TEST(entry_name_utils, InvalidSequence) { |
| 32 | // 0xfe is an invalid start byte |
| 33 | const uint8_t invalid[] = { 0x41, 0xfe }; |
| 34 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(invalid, sizeof(invalid))); |
| 35 | |
| 36 | // 0x91 is an invalid start byte (it's a valid continuation byte). |
| 37 | const uint8_t invalid2[] = { 0x41, 0x91 }; |
| 38 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(invalid2, sizeof(invalid2))); |
| 39 | } |
| 40 | |
| 41 | TEST(entry_name_utils, TruncatedContinuation) { |
| 42 | // Malayalam script with truncated bytes. There should be 2 bytes |
| 43 | // after 0xe0 |
| 44 | const uint8_t truncated[] = { 0xe0, 0xb4, 0x85, 0xe0, 0xb4 }; |
| 45 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(truncated, sizeof(truncated))); |
| 46 | |
| 47 | // 0xc2 is the start of a 2 byte sequence that we've subsequently |
| 48 | // dropped. |
| 49 | const uint8_t truncated2[] = { 0xc2, 0xc2, 0xa1 }; |
| 50 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(truncated2, sizeof(truncated2))); |
| 51 | } |
| 52 | |
| 53 | TEST(entry_name_utils, BadContinuation) { |
| 54 | // 0x41 is an invalid continuation char, since it's MSBs |
| 55 | // aren't "10..." (are 01). |
| 56 | const uint8_t bad[] = { 0xc2, 0xa1, 0xc2, 0x41 }; |
| 57 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(bad, sizeof(bad))); |
| 58 | |
| 59 | // 0x41 is an invalid continuation char, since it's MSBs |
| 60 | // aren't "10..." (are 11). |
| 61 | const uint8_t bad2[] = { 0xc2, 0xa1, 0xc2, 0xfe }; |
| 62 | ASSERT_FALSE(IsValidEntryName(bad2, sizeof(bad2))); |
| 63 | } |
